Book excerpt: This book is new, comprehensive and clinically relevant with in-depth focus on anterior segment diseases. It concentrates on the vital areas of the eye surface abnormalities including pathology of tear film, diseases of conjunctiva, eyelids, cornea and sclera, developmental abnormalities and tumors. The majority of the book chapters follow the template including: introduction; clinical signs and symptoms; investigations; differential diagnosis; general principles of treatment and prognosis. This volume deals with all types of anterior segment diseases especially congenital and developmental anomalies, tear film disorders (dry eye), various conjunctival and corneal diseases (infectious, inflammatory, neoplastic, degenerative and trauma), sclera and episclera, iris and ciliary body and finally keratoplasty in a comprehensive manner.

Book excerpt: In Focus Ophthalmology is aimed at all medical and health science students who require an introductory, low cost and highly illustrated guide to this specialty. The material is presented in double page spreads. The left-hand page has a synoptic and highly structured text (normally under the following headings: incidence; clinical features; differential diagnosis; management; prognosis). The right-hand page has a selection of four to six clinical photographs. Ophthalmology In Focus is a convenient pocket size and therefore ideal for quick preparation before ward rounds. Each volume also includes self-assessment material, which is extremely helpful for preparation for examinations. Because of shorter hospital stays and more outpatient treatment, students are less likely to be able to see the full range of conditions on the ward - the books in this series help supply that deficit.
